Jane McDonald appeared on James Martin’s Saturday Morning to share her excitement about her upcoming album Living The Dream and 2026 UK tour

Jane McDonald is heading on tour later this year (Image: ITV)
Vocal powerhouse Jane McDonald has expressed her thrill at performing in Leeds and Sheffield as part of her forthcoming arena tour.
The television host and singer appeared on James Martin’s Saturday Morning on March 14 to discuss her imminent album Living The Dream.
Jane’s 11th studio album, featuring nine original tracks and four country classics, will be promoted with a UK tour in 2026 later this year.
The tour commences in Derby on August 28 and travels across the UK before concluding in Leeds on September 26.
Discussing the creation of her new music, she revealed: “I started writing [the album] and all of a sudden I said, ‘This sounds a bit country’. So I said, ‘Why don’t we go to Nashville to do it?’ and we had the most amazing time.”

“I recorded it at the Blackbird Studio, which is where Taylor Swift and Coldplay did their album. I mean, I’ve got no money left, but it doesn’t matter, does it?”.
“I’ve gone from Abbey Road to Nashville and it’s just one of those albums that I just can’t wait for people to hear it and it’s out next week. I took a TV crew with me and I think that’s coming out in about four weeks.”
Jane further conveyed her anticipation at taking to the stage at Leeds Arena during her upcoming tour later this year.

She elaborated: “Well, I can’t believe it really. Because we’ve got the new album, we decided to tour the album and the last tour did so well and we’d start to sort of dip into arenas then. So now there’s only about two or three theatres in the whole tour now.
“Leeds Arena is like my own turf in it. I get to sleep in my own bed. It’s just little things like that that cheer you up isn’t it?”.
“So, I just can’t believe it and it’s August and September that we’re out on tour. We’re going to Sheffield Arena and Manchester Arena too.”
